Filics secures €13.5M in financing to expand and roll out its robotics platform
The “Filics Unit” is the first product and consists of two omnidirectional robots that have been specially developed for handling Euro pallets. The system moves autonomously through the warehouse, traveling under pallets and transporting them.

Kassow Robots Introduces Sensitive Arm Technology for Enhanced Collaborative Robotics
The Sensitive Arm system provides real-time, low-latency force feedback while utilizing integrated torque sensors across all joints. With a sensor resolution of up to 0.024 Nm/bit and a control frequency of 30 kHz, the system enables compliant and nuanced motions essential for complex tasks such as assembly, surface finishing, inspection and delicate handling.
